My recommendation:

Jeff Buckley - Mojo Pin

I just recently picked up the Legacy Edition of Grace, which features Grace, fully remastered, a bonus disc featuring some previously unreleased tracks (Forget Her [I think it\'s called] is a great, never-before heard song on this disc) and a DVD featuring an extended Making-Of documentary, and his video-clips.

For anyone who is a fan, I would highly recommend this album. Or anyone who is open enough to listen to an album with a lot of broad and varied inspiration, from a musicion with a maturity years ahead of himself and a voice so haunting and passionate it\'s enough to make you cry.. buy it now.
